Relieving Chest Pain and Preventing Heart Attacks
The Impact of Angioplasty on Cardiac Health
- Improves blood supply: Post-angioplasty, the heart receives an enhanced blood supply, ensuring sufficient oxygenation which is vital for cardiac tissue health.
- Reduces angina: Angioplasty targets the alleviation of angina—a common symptom of coronary artery disease caused by reduced blood flow—enhancing patients’ quality of life.
- Lowers heart attack risk: By restoring optimal blood flow, the risk of myocardial infarctions, or heart attacks, is significantly diminished, showcasing the preventive aspect of the procedure.
- Coronary artery disease: Angioplasty directly addresses the underlying pathophysiology of coronary artery disease—improving overall patient health and longevity.
Angioplasty: Not a Permanent Cure
Sustaining Heart Health Beyond the Procedure
- Improves blood flow: While angioplasty restores arterial functionality, it does not eliminate underlying risk factors that led to arterial blockages in the first place.
- Lifestyle changes needed: To sustain the benefits of the procedure, adopting heart-healthy habits becomes crucial in long-term prevention of stenosis.
- Medications to prevent blockages: Post-procedure pharmacotherapy, particularly with antiplatelet agents, is essential to mitigate risks of subsequent clot formation and occlusion.
-
Long-term management: Angioplasty should be a part of a comprehensive strategy that includes regular health check-ups and ongoing cardiovascular care.
Less Invasive than Open-Heart Surgery
Advantages of Angioplasty Techniques
Small incision
The procedure requires only a tiny incision, often performed in the wrist or groin, significantly lessening surgical trauma compared to open-heart approaches.
Wrist or groin access
Accessing the arterial system from these sites allows for greater convenience and reduced patient discomfort during the intervention.
Shorter recovery time
Patients typically return to normal activities more quickly than with traditional surgery, which is advantageous for both patients and healthcare systems.
Patient comfort
Minimally invasive techniques result in reduced pain and better post-operative recovery experiences for patients, enhancing overall satisfaction.
Understanding the Risks Involved
Complications Associated with Angioplasty
Bleeding
Minor bleeding at the catheter insertion site can occur, necessitating monitoring to ensure patient safety and prompt intervention if necessary.
Infection
As with any invasive procedure, there is a potential for infection at the insertion site or, less commonly, systemic infections.
Restenosis
There remains a risk of the artery re-narrowing after the procedure; ongoing monitoring is essential to identify this complication early.
Rare complications: heart attack, stroke
While infrequent, there exists a possibility of acute complications such as heart attacks or strokes during or after the procedure, underscoring the importance of thorough candidate evaluation.
Candidate Selection for Angioplasty
Criteria for Candidates
Not suitable for everyone
A thorough assessment is necessary to determine if angioplasty is the most appropriate intervention for each individual patient, as varied presentations of coronary disease exist.
Multiple blockages
Patients with numerous blockages or complex coronary artery disease may not benefit from a single angioplasty, prompting consideration of other surgical options.
Severe artery damage
Those with significant vessel damage may require alternative therapies, such as coronary bypass surgery, rather than angioplasty to address their condition.
Alternative: coronary bypass surgery
In cases where angioplasty may not suffice, coronary bypass may offer a more viable solution for restoring blood flow effectively.
Essential Lifestyle Changes Post-Angioplasty
Strategies for Sustained Heart Health
Heart-healthy diet: An emphasis on a balanced diet rich in fruits, vegetables, lean proteins, and whole grains is vital in preventing future blockages and supporting optimal health.
Regular exercise: Incorporating physical activity into daily routines strengthens the heart and reduces cardiovascular risk factors following angioplasty.
Smoking cessation: Quitting smoking is critical to improving cardiovascular health and decreasing the likelihood of future complications after angioplasty.
Blood pressure and cholesterol management: Monitoring and managing these key health metrics are essential to sustaining heart health and preventing recurrent issues after the procedure.
Importance of Follow-Up Care
Monitoring Health After Angioplasty
Regular check-ups: Scheduled healthcare visits allow for assessment of heart health and identification of any new or recurring symptoms after angioplasty.
Medications like blood thinners: Prescription medications, such as antiplatelet agents, are vital to prevent clotting and ensure sustained blood flow following the procedure.
Monitoring artery status: Ongoing imaging and clinical assessments are crucial in identifying any changes in artery condition post-angioplasty.
Preventing complications: Proactive monitoring and intervention strategies can mitigate potential complications, supporting overall health and well-being.
